Default Questions before I buy

1) Is there any sort of discounts for buying modules when I buy flashchat rather than buy them later? I'd love to have the whiteboard, for example, but it costs more than FlashChat itself does!
2) I want to add emotions and avatars, but don't want to pay you to do it. I'm passable enough in Flash, I can create them. Can I add them myself?
3) I spoke to one of your reps about 123FlashChat last year, and they said the support was six months and after that 20% of the purchase price per year. Has it now changed to three months and 30%?
4) Can I modify the videos and MP3s played in the embedded video player? If so, how? I can't figure this out in the demo.

Dear Joe, thanks for writing us!

>1) Is there any sort of discounts for buying modules when I buy flashchat rather than buy them later? I'd love to have the whiteboard, for example, but it costs more than FlashChat itself does!

I'm afraid no discount is available for modules along with license purchase.
The point is the modules are designed to enhance the chat features while they're not obligatory, therefore user can buy only necessary according to their needs.
In this case, you may buy modules now with the license or later.
The whiteboard module costs $499, it can function on two conditions: a. 123flashchat license, b. Flash media server which you may purchase from Macromedia server, so the module itself is like a key to turn on the function on 123flashchat, and you can see the major part to cost you a fortune is actually the FMS server.

>2) I want to add emotions and avatars, but don't want to pay you to do it. I'm passable enough in Flash, I can create them. Can I add them myself?

The bad news is that the flash source code is not available for sale, so technically you can't add it by yourself.
But you may create some according to the spec. we've announced in the FAQ,
http://www.123flashchat.com/design-faq.html#a6
once you're done, send them in a ZIP to us, we'll replace for you.
It's gonna take some time of us so the developing fee will be charged, but considering the major work is done by yourself, the price is negotiable.
Is that acceptable?

>3) I spoke to one of your reps about 123FlashChat last year, and they said the support was six months and after that 20% of the purchase price per year. Has it now changed to three months and 30%?

Don't worry, the old policy remains

>4) Can I modify the videos and MP3s played in the embedded video player? If so, how? I can't figure this out in the demo.

Yes, fortunately you may do the video and MP3 configuration in the Admin Panel-> room settings-> specific room, edit media.
